Step 4: Enable the retention sweeper on Corvidane. The sweeper deletes records older than the policy window, in batches, during the low-traffic window. Do not run it against the replica — it must target the primary or tombstones won't propagate. Verify the dry-run flag is on for the first pass and check the deletion counts against the audit log. Once counts look sane, flip dry-run off and redeploy. Apply the sweeper configuration exactly as shown below.

settings of bawif-fawif:
ralix:
  log_level: warn
  metrics_host: metrics.ralix.tolvaqsys.internal
  pool_size: 32

## Runbook: Crumbline Order-Cutoff Enforcement

Crumbline bakery orders lock at the configured cutoff each evening. After cutoff, the scheduler rejects new orders and queues them for the next window. If customers report orders slipping through, check that the cutoff service restarted with current settings — stale processes are the usual culprit. Restart via the standard deploy job. Current enforcement settings follow.

service settings:
PRAIX_LOG_LEVEL=error
PRAIX_METRICS_HOST=metrics.praix.qorvelcorp.corp
PRAIX_POOL_SIZE=16

## Deployment

This section covers deploying the Tumblevault locker access service for the Brinmore laundry facilities. The access flow issues short-lived unlock tokens after a resident scans their locker code; tokens are validated against the Tumblevault gateway before the latch releases. Deploy the gateway first, then the latch controllers, and verify a full scan-to-unlock cycle in staging before promoting. As release manager, confirm the deployed build carries the exact configuration values shown below.

deployment values, kagap-hahif:
[queneth]
port = 5672
region = south-4
host = queneth.qirvantech.local
team = istir
timeout_ms = 1500
retries = 2

# Environments: PinPoint Autocomplete

Three environments: dev, staging, prod. Dev resets nightly. Staging mirrors prod data minus the Harwick dataset. Promotions go dev → staging → prod; no direct prod pushes. Staging smoke tests must pass before release sign-off. Prod config is locked behind change review. Current staging values are as follows.

settings of kafop-fahog:
PRAWYN_PIN=8793
PRAWYN_METRICS_HOST=metrics.prawyn.lumiccorp.corp
PRAWYN_LOG_LEVEL=warn
PRAWYN_TENANT=kasox